本文目录导读:
数据库三模式结构是数据库管理系统中的一种基本架构,它将数据库系统分为三个层次,分别为概念模式、内部模式和外模式,本文将对数据库三模式结构中的名词进行详细解释,并结合实际应用实例进行阐述。
二、概念模式(Conceptual Schema)
1、定义:概念模式是数据库系统中全体数据的逻辑结构和特征的描述,它反映了设计者的全局数据视图。
图片来源于网络,如有侵权联系删除
2、关键名词解释:
(1)数据结构:指数据库中数据的组织方式,如层次结构、网状结构、关系结构等。
(2)数据完整性:指数据库中数据的正确性、一致性和有效性,包括实体完整性、参照完整性和用户定义完整性。
(3)数据约束:指对数据库中数据的限制条件,如主键约束、外键约束、唯一性约束等。
(4)数据视图:指用户对数据库中数据的局部或全局视图,如用户视图、视图视图等。
3、应用实例:概念模式在数据库设计阶段起到重要作用,如E-R图(实体-联系图)就是一种常用的概念模式设计工具。
三、内部模式(Internal Schema)
1、定义:内部模式是数据库系统中数据的物理结构和存储方式的描述,它反映了数据在数据库中的实际存储形式。
图片来源于网络,如有侵权联系删除
2、关键名词解释:
(1)存储结构:指数据库中数据的存储方式,如堆、堆文件、索引等。
(2)存储过程:指数据库中用于处理数据的程序,如插入、删除、查询等。
(3)索引:指数据库中用于提高查询效率的数据结构,如B树、哈希表等。
(4)缓冲区:指数据库中用于存储数据页的内存区域。
3、应用实例:内部模式在数据库实现阶段起到关键作用,如数据库优化器就是根据内部模式来选择最优查询计划的。
外模式(External Schema)
1、定义:外模式是数据库系统中数据的局部逻辑结构和特征的描述,它反映了用户对数据库的局部视图。
2、关键名词解释:
图片来源于网络,如有侵权联系删除
(1)局部数据结构:指数据库中用户局部数据的组织方式,如表格、视图等。
(2)用户视图:指用户对数据库的局部视图,如视图视图、用户视图等。
(3)用户约束:指用户对数据库数据的限制条件,如用户定义的完整性约束等。
(4)视图:指数据库中用户对数据的局部或全局视图。
3、应用实例:外模式在数据库应用阶段起到重要作用,如SQL查询语句就是根据外模式来获取数据的。
数据库三模式结构是数据库管理系统中的一种基本架构,它将数据库系统分为概念模式、内部模式和外模式三个层次,本文对数据库三模式结构中的名词进行了详细解释,并结合实际应用实例进行了阐述,了解数据库三模式结构对于数据库设计、实现和应用具有重要意义。
标签: #数据库的三模式结构名词解释
评论列表